If the floorboards under the carpet squeak drive a wallboard screw all the way through the carpet and pad into the floor joist countersinking the screw head into the subfloor. If you are building a new home or when replacing flooring in an old home make sure to screw down the entire subfloor using 2 1 2 to 3 case hardened drywall screws.
